I grabbed the 360 version on saturday when street date broke here and tbh I have been enjoying it enough that I grabbed the PC + season pass from GMG yesterday because the only problem I have had on 360 so far has been shitty 480p seeming resolution and textures, am hoping pc version will fix that.

I haven't tried multiplayer yet and only got a few missions in to the campaign but just playing those after Dead Space 3 reminded me of what tension and pacing in a game like this should be. I was scanning everywhere as I was moving through the levels, walking backwards so I could watch the rear etc. Yes the firefights are fast and it's a killfest game when that occurs but while you are wandering through corridors full of alien slime, opened eggs, dead facehuggers, motion tracker out and see movement out the corner of your eye but then see nothing (because the xeno's blend like a motherfucker with their hardened slime) it gets tense.

The marine AI is shitty, though I'm hoping that the drop-in co-op will help with that once more people have it, and some of the items you need to interact with (like consoles) are a little hard to see at times to the point I restarted a checkpoint because I thought the AI had bugged out but it was just that I didn't see a console but the enemy AI so far has been fairly good with plenty of flanking and other tactics being used by the two types of enemies I've come across so far.

I'm liking it, certainly a lot more than DS3, and the fact it's canonical means that a fan of the universe really needs to at least be up to speed on what happens in it but I am only a few missions in and can accept it might end up being shit but so far I'm ranking it as looking to be around a 7/10 if it stays at this level (not taking in to account the multiplayer as it doesn't really interest me that much)

I unlocked the PC version via VPN and played... Holy fuck. I don't know what I just played. I'll cross post.

Ok confirming: The campaign is horrid. Aliens are as we feared. Most of the time they just get stuck walking around and are no challenge what so ever. One went back and forth, forward and back, and I watched wondering what it was doing. If I didn't know any better, this was a new Michael Jackson Moonwalker Alien. About the only way this entire single player experience can redeem itself is with a friend, in coop, extremely fucking hammered and laughing our asses off that we bought this game.

Hopefully multiplayer will save the day here. I cannot test that on this VPN I am on. It's pretty laggy so will wait for tomorrow.

Music, sounds, all what you would expect.

I swear to God they used existing Art Assets from the PS2 version. Some of the textures are SO bad. They look like green / red blobs when they are supposed to be various electronic equipment. The voice acting is horrible. This isn't a spoiler I do not think but this is what one lady said over a comm channel... In the most monotone voice you could ever imagine. "Yeah. This thing attached to my face. I'm ok now though. It was weird."

I am so glad I only paid $37.99 for this. I wouldn't recommend this at $9.99 so far. Again, reinstating I hope the multiplayer is good.

and...

So I just watched as one Alien decided to turn it's back to me and sit there staring at a wall doing nothing. Another decided it would be a good idea to go under a grate... the only problem, the tail was clipping right through it. I also had an Alien, after I shot it, hang in mid-air by itself just... suspended in the air upside down not attached to anything.

Holy fuck. They should be issuing fucking refunds.

developers were streaming multiplayer on Twitch, playing on xbox. seemed meh. they were bad at the game, so hard to tell how balanced it was. it played a lot like L4D, each side got a turn at aliens(infected) or marines(survivors). there's at least 3 types of aliens i think. the normal jump around and slash. one that stays in the back and spits. and a bigger one that slashes but doesn't seem to move as fast. dunno. graphics weren't that impressive, but streaming an xbox, so who knows.
